To determine where the function is negative, you’ll need to analyze the function you’ve been given. Typically, this involves finding the points where the function crosses the x-axis (roots) and testing intervals around these points to see if the function values are negative.

Assuming that the function has a root at x = 0.75, you would check the sign of the function in the intervals before and after 0.75:

1. For x < 0.75, choose a test point (e.g., x = 0). If the function is positive there, it means the function is positive in this interval.
2. For x > 0.75, choose a test point (e.g., x = 1). If the function is negative there, it means the function is negative in this interval.
